A New Internet-Draft is available from the on-line Internet-Drafts directories. This draft is a work item of the Session PEERing for Multimedia INTerconnect Working Group of the IETF. Title : Use of DNS SRV and NAPTR Records for SPEERMINT Author(s) : T. Creighton, J. Livingood Filename : draft-ietf-speermint-srv-naptr-use-05.txt Pages : 13 Date : 2009-03-05 The objective of this document is to specify the Best Current Practice (BCP) adopted by a service provider or other organization providing multimedia communication services such as Voice over Internet Protocol(VoIP) in order to locate another service provider to peer with in the context of Session PEERing for Multimedia INTerconnect. This document attempts to fill the gaps in information from RFC 3261, RFC 3263, and other documents, in order to more assist service providers in more easily performing SIP peering.
